Chap seeking to probe apprentice's financial record (6,4)

Ross

I believe the answer is:

cheque stub

'financial record' is the definition.
(I know that cheque stub is a type of financial record)

'chap seeking to probe apprentice's' is the wordplay.
'chap' becomes 'he'.
'seeking' becomes 'quest' (synonyms).
'to probe' is an insertion indicator (probe can mean to poke or prod into).
'apprentice' becomes 'cub' (I've seen this in another clue).
'he'+'quest'='hequest'
'hequest' inserted within 'cub' is 'CHEQUE STUB'.

(Other definitions for cheque stub that I've seen before include "Record of a bill of payment" , "remainder of payment?" , "Payment counterfoil" .)
